UNIVERSITY OF OXFORD
CENTRE FOR FUNCTIONAL MRI OF THE BRAIN (FMRIB)
POSTDOCTORAL RESEARCH ASSISTANT: Diffusion tractography of
thalamo-cortical circuitry
Academic-related Research Staff Grade 1A: Salary £19460-29128 p.a.
The Centre for Functional Magnetic Resonance Imaging of the Brain seeks
a postdoctoral research assistant to develop a program of research (with
Dr H Johansen-Berg) to examine subcortical-cortical circuitry using
non-invasive diffusion MRI tractography. This project would form part of
a multi-centre collaboration funded by the BBSRC and will involve
interactions with other groups using FMRI, computer modelling and single
unit recording. The ideal candidate should have a doctorate in a
relevant discipline. Research experience in neuroimaging or neuroanatomy
is essential. Employment could begin from February 2005 for a period of
2 years. For an outline of the lab's research interests and links to
